Intermediate efficiency of tests under heavy-tailed alternatives

02/18/2019
by   Tadeusz Inglot, et al.
0

We show that for local alternatives which are not square integrable the intermediate (or Kallenberg) efficiency of the Neyman-Pearson test for uniformity with respect to the classical Kolmogorov-Smirnov test is equal to infinity. Contrary to this, for local square integrable alternatives the intermediate efficiency is finite and can be explicitly calculated.
